Sleep Summit Recap from the SSA Chairman

October 21, 2024

by Pascal Roberge, SSA Chair and Director of Sales • Beaudoin

Last week, The Fam hosted its second annual Sleep Summit in Bentonville, AR—a dynamic two-day event filled with great presenters, impactful insights, and an amazing collaborative energy!

Summits are for unlocking solutions

With the theme of the event being Back to the Future … of Sleep, the presenters were all focused on the critical question: How do we raise the bar in presenting options for better sleep to our customers? From discussions on innovative products to strategies for enhancing the customer experience, every session was focused on improving our collective contribution to a better night’s rest for everyone.
The line-up of speakers was fantastic again this year.

  1. Start with Emotion: Brett Thorton’s advice resonated deeply: crafting a great presentation is all about how you want your audience to feel. Whether you’re in sales, marketing, or product development, tapping into the emotional impact of your message is essential!!
  2. The Mattress Isn’t Always Top of Mind: Colin Lawlor’s session highlighted a surprising truth—the mattress is too far down the list of what consumers think of when seeking better sleep. We need to rethink how we communicate the importance of a quality mattress and the surrounding products in the larger conversation about sleep health!
  3. Make a Friend! Brent Batterman reminded us of the simplest yet most powerful tool in our industry: connection. “Make a friend” is not just a motto for sales associates on the floor—it’s a philosophy we can all adopt in our daily interactions, whether you’re a retailer or a supplier.

Events like The Fam’s Sleep Summit highlight the importance of community in the sleep industry. Summits like this one are not just about education—they’re about unlocking solutions together.

One of the standout moments was the creative Pitch Off, where participating exhibitors took the stage for an interactive, fast-paced session that had everyone engaged. It was super dynamic and showed how much innovation and creativity our industry can bring to the table.
